Output 8106e72372966d231841c30319534340f80510adfe95b52889136e8fc2c2c568:2

value
43048469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f372a954515b8cfb22624c58c1250cea7080db8b OP_EQUAL
address
MW6PnrvztdmxyB9uXFXxog5uLM9ubY45MF
transaction
8106e72372966d231841c30319534340f80510adfe95b52889136e8fc2c2c568
spent
true